Abstract
The invention discloses a high-tear-resistance heat-conducting silicone rubber which comprises the following components in parts by weight: 120-200 parts of methylvinyl silicone rubber, 24-30 parts of high-wear-resistance carbon black, 50-70 parts of precipitation-process silica white, 33-48 parts of ceramic powder 12-18 parts of aluminum powder, 43-53 parts of silicon nitride, 11-17 parts of hydroxy silicon oil, 0.1-0.5 part of chloroplatinic acid, 8-11 parts of silane coupling agent, 2-4 parts of alkynol inhibitor, 1-2 parts of aromatic oil and 11-13 parts of 2,5-dimethyl-2,5-bis(tert-butylperoxy)hexane vulcanizing agent. The silicone rubber has the advantages of low price, favorable product appearance, high tear strength, favorable heat-conducting property and the like.

A preparation method for high tear heat-conducting silicon rubber, it comprises the steps:
1) by weight, methyl vinyl silicone rubber 120 ~ 200 parts is put in mixing roll, high wear-resistant carbon black 24 ~ 30 parts, precipitated silica 50 ~ 70 parts, ceramics powder 33 ~ 48 parts, aluminium powder 12 ~ 18 parts, silicon nitride 43 ~ 53 parts, hydroxy silicon oil 11 ~ 17 parts, Platinic chloride 0.1 ~ 0.5 part, silane coupling agent 8 ~ 11 parts, 2 ~ 4 parts, alkynol class inhibitor, aromatic hydrocarbon oil 1 ~ 2 part and two two or five vulcanizing agent 11 ~ 13 parts, and mixing roll temperature is adjusted to 80 ~ 100 DEG C, vacuum tightness is 0.01 ~ 0.1MPa, then start to stir, stirring velocity is 40 ~ 70r/min, churning time is 20 ~ 45 minutes, obtain blend glue stuff,
2) blend glue stuff of gained is left standstill cooling 15 ~ 30 minutes;
3) cooled batch mixing is put on advection tabletting machine and is carried out one step cure, and curing temperature is 100 ~ 200 DEG C, and air pressure is 10 ~ 20MPa, and the time is 30 ~ 50 minutes;
4) material after one step cure is put into baking oven and is carried out post vulcanization, and curing temperature is 30 ~ 250 DEG C, and air pressure is normal pressure, and the time is 5 ~ 7 hours;
5) packaging is produced.

Embodiment 1:
A kind of high tear heat-conducting silicon rubber, by weight, it comprises following composition,
Wherein, the contents of ethylene of methyl vinyl silicone rubber is 0.05mol%, and molecular weight is roughly 550,000.
Silane coupling agent is the mixing of γ-aminopropyl triethoxysilane and γ-(2,3 glycidoxy) propyl trimethoxy silicane.
Alkynol class inhibitor is acetylene basic ring alcohol.
The preparation method of this high tear heat-conducting silicon rubber comprises the steps:
1) by weight, methyl vinyl silicone rubber 120 parts is put in mixing roll, high wear-resistant carbon black 24 parts, precipitated silica 50 parts, ceramics powder 33 parts, aluminium powder 12 parts, silicon nitride 43 parts, hydroxy silicon oil 11 parts, Platinic chloride 0.1 part, γ-aminopropyl triethoxysilane and γ-(2, 3 glycidoxies) mixed solution 8 parts of propyl trimethoxy silicane, acetylene basic ring is alcohol 2 parts, aromatic hydrocarbon oil 1 part and two two or five vulcanizing agent 11 parts, and mixing roll temperature is adjusted to 80 DEG C, vacuum tightness is-0.01MPa, then start to stir, stirring velocity is 40r/min, churning time is 20 minutes, obtain blend glue stuff,
2) blend glue stuff of gained is left standstill cooling 15 minutes;
3) cooled batch mixing is put on advection tabletting machine and is carried out one step cure, and curing temperature is 100 DEG C, and air pressure is 10MPa, and the time is 30 minutes;
4) material after one step cure is put into baking oven and is carried out post vulcanization, and curing temperature is 30 ~ 250 DEG C, and air pressure is normal pressure, and the time is at least 6 hours;
5) packaging is produced.
Wherein step 4) comprising:
A. during temperature 25 DEG C, sulfuration 15 minutes;
B. during temperature 100 DEG C, sulfuration 60 minutes;
C. during temperature 180 DEG C, sulfuration 120 minutes;
D. during temperature 250 DEG C, sulfuration 220 minutes.
